3 PHS Graduation Requirements  Attend Advisory  Junior Paper  Senior Project  Student Led Conference YOU MUST PASS YOUR OAKS TESTS!  Reading (236)  Math(236)  Writing (40) English (4) Math (3) [Algebra I and above] Science (3) Social Studies (3) PE (1) Health (1) Advisor (1) Second language/Arts/CTE (3) Electives (6) Total credits: 25

8 PSAT / SAT/ ACT  PSAT in October of Sophomore Year  You may take it as a Junior.  SAT/ ACT should be taken Spring of Junior Year  SAT test you on Critical Reasoning, Mathematics, and a required Writing Test.  ACT test you on English, Mathematics, Reading, Science, and an optional Writing Test

9 Applying to College: It is more than just your GPA Extracurriculars Interview Essays Recommendations Test scoresGrades/Class rank Volunteering “X” Preparation Application No one factor determines acceptance
